We are seeking a highly qualified and experienced Senior Responsible Sourcing Auditor to conduct social compliance, labor, health & safety, environmental, and ethical audits across various industries. The successful candidate will lead audit activities, manage client relationships, mentor junior auditors, and ensure audit delivery complies with international standards and customer requirements.
Key Responsibilities
Audit Execution
- Lead and conduct social compliance and responsible sourcing audits in accordance with client protocols and international standards.
- Perform document reviews, worker interviews, management interviews, and facility inspections.
- Evaluate compliance with labor laws, human rights requirements, occupational health & safety regulations, and environmental requirements.
- Identify non-conformities and prepare accurate audit findings and reports.
- Ensure audit reports are completed and submitted within required timelines.
Technical Expertise
- Conduct audits against recognized standards and programs, including:
- SMETA
- WRAP
- SLCP
- RBA VAP
- Customer-specific Codes of Conduct
- Provide technical guidance on labor rights, ethical recruitment, working hours, wages & benefits, occupational safety, and management systems.
- Support factories in understanding compliance requirements and audit expectations.
